Job Description

This position is the Workload Manager. This position conducts research and
evaluation develops and manages information systems (i.e. complaint and incident tracking
systems) conducts evaluations of complaint investigations assigns priority levels for each
complaint received assists in assigning staff to particular complaints and incidents needing
further investigation and coordinates law enforcement referrals and investigations.

DESCRIPTION OF DUTIES:

Conducts program and information system analysis on a statewide basis.
Assists in implementation of enforcement orders such as emergency closure orders
and prohibition of access orders.
Schedules and coordinates all licensed setting inspections for the region. Conducts
meetings with licensing staff for scheduling and other matters.
Oversees the regional fines management system reviewing and evaluating corrective
action plans and monitors the implementation. Conducts onsite inspections for verifying
corrective action plans.

Coordinates referrals and criminal investigations with law enforcement agencies including
state and local police and Office of the Attorney General.
Reviews content of incident reports and complaints. Followsup with providers and
complainants as needed for additional information. Assesses and assigns priority levels
for complaints and incident reports received. Assigns complaint/incident inspections
to the Licensing Representatives/Technicians for further investigation.
Files incident reports and other licensing documents or scans such documents to
electronic records.
Designs and conducts research studies relating to licensed settings.
Assists in data entry and data analysis relating to licensed settings. Takes complaints and
enters them into the complaint tracking system. Enters incident reports into incident
tracking system.
Generates weekly and monthly reports and ad hoc reports using data collection methods
and tools; prepares tables and graphs from analysis for inclusion in Departmental
statistical reports.
Ensure data integrity through regular monitoring of database systems.
Organizes and analyzes data which may involve reviewing regulator information or
applying statistical methods to analyze data in order to draw conclusions make
recommendations and suggest system improvements and program alternatives.
Reviews analyzes and recommends revisions to existing and proposed policies regulations
and procedures.
Coordinates the maintenance of information technology applications to support
program operations.
Responds to inquiries from providers other state and local agency officials
consumers Department licensing staff and Department program offices.
Oversees the usage of equipment for the region; coordinates all necessary equipment
needed to conduct presentations and training provided in the regional office.
Provides guidance and direction to licensing representatives/technicians in the regional
office regarding complaint and incident information and their respective tracking
systems.
Provides technical support for all staff in the office. Provides training to staff on
equipment database systems and software programs.
Performs related work as required.


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

1. Valid driver s license due to travel. Occasional overnight travel throughout
the Commonwealth predominantly in an assigned geographical area;
2. Writes clear and concise policy and procedures;
3. Gathers and analyzes regulatory and statistical data to apply it to complex regulations
and laws;
4. Comprehends state and federal laws and regulations to conduct national and
state research;
5. Ability to use computer equipment effectively peripherals software applications
and other office equipment.
6. Ability to communicate verbally and in writing;
7. Prepares weekly and monthly ad hoc statistical and narrative reports;
8. Maintains licensing software applications tracking systems and equipment

Requirements

Requirements:

Minimum Educational Requirements:
Bachelor s degree in a Health or Human services related course of study. Examples but
not limited to: Nursing Social work Psychology Occupational Therapist Physical
Therapist Physician Emergency Medical Technician (EMT)
OR
Associates Degree in a Health or Human Services related course of study AND 2
years experience working in that field of study
OR
A minimum of one year experience in a health or human services related field
demonstrating an ability to perform the description of duties and essential functions.
